Mr. Raj Mohan Singh, J.: - Accused Kuldeep Singh is in appeal against judgment of conviction dated 27.11.2003 and order of sentence dated 28.11.2003 passed by Special Judge (Under Prevention of Corruption Act, 1988), Kurukshetra.

2. FIR No.508 dated 15.11.1999 was registered under Section 7 and 13 of P.C. Act, 1988, in Police Station, City Thanesar, District Kurukshetra. Complainant Balwant Singh in his complaint (Exhibit PB), alleged that he is resident of village Dauda Kheri. Land of Lala Banarsi is in their possession and in respect of mutation and girdawari, Kuldeep Singh, Patwari demanded Rs.10,000/- as bribe. It has been alleged that Kuldeep Singh, Patwari does not do the work without money. Earlier also, complainant has paid an amount to Kuldeep Singh, Patwari for this work. He used to come out of Udasian Dera in Sehan for accepting the amount. Complainant along with Ram Singh went to DSP, Kurukshetra along with amount as he did not want to give the amount as bribe to the Patwari and action was sought against him.
